Tuner unit 110 tunes the channel selected with user among the RF broadcast singal received by antenna Or any one corresponding radio frequency (RF) broadcast singal in pre-stored channel.Then, tuner unit 110 will be adjusted Humorous RF broadcast singal is converted into intermediate frequency (IF) signal or base band video or audio signal.
For example, when tuned RF broadcast singal is digital broadcast signal, tuner unit 110 turns RF broadcast singal Change digital IF (DIF) signal into.When tuned RF broadcast singal is analog broadcast signal, tuner unit 110 is wide by RF Broadcast signal and be converted into ABB video or audio signal (frequency (CVBS/ between composite video banking sync/sound carrier SIF) signal).That is, tuner unit 110 can not only be handled digital broadcast signal and can handle analog broadcasting The mixing tuner of signal.The ABB video or audio signal (CVBS/SIF signals) exported from tuner unit 110 Controller 170 can be directly input into.
In addition, tuner unit 110 is from Advanced Television Systems Committee's (ATSC) system single-carrier system or from numeral Video broadcasting (DVB) multicarrier system receives RF broadcast singal.
In the present invention, tuner unit 110 can be tuned sequentially from the RF broadcast singal received by antenna It is central with via the corresponding RF broadcast singal of the previously stored all broadcasting channels of channel store function, and can be by RF Broadcast singal is converted into IF signals or base band video or audio signal.
Meanwhile, in order to receive the broadcast singal corresponding with multiple channels, tuner unit 110 can include multiple tunings Device.Alternatively, the single tuner for the broadcast singal that multiple channels can be received simultaneously is possible.
Demodulator 120 receives the DIF signals changed in tuner unit 110 and it is demodulated.
After demodulation channel decoding is performed, demodulator 120 can export stream signal (transmitting stream (TS) signal).At this In the case of sample, stream signal can be obtained by multiplexed video signal, audio or data-signal.
The stream signal exported from demodulator 120 can be input into controller 170.Controller 170 can realize demultiplexing, Video/audio (A/V) signal transacting etc. also, then, processed vision signal can be output to display 180 and Processed audio signal is output to audio output unit 185.

Refer to the attached drawing, controller 170 according to an embodiment of the invention can include demultiplexer 310, at image Manage unit 320, processor 330, OSD maker 340, frequency mixer 345, block diagram of frame rate converter 350 and formatter 360.Controller 170 may further include audio process (not shown) and data processor (not shown).
Demultiplexer 310 demultiplexes inlet flow.For example, when the demultiplexer 310 that MPEG-2TS is transfused to, demultiplexer 310 can demultiplex into MPEG-2TS image, audio and data-signal.Here, being input into the stream of demultiplexer 310 Signal can be the stream signal exported from tuner unit 110, demodulator 120 or external apparatus interface unit 130.
Graphics processing unit 320 can perform image procossing to the picture signal being demultiplexed.Therefore, graphics processing unit 320 can include image decoder 325 and scaler 335.
325 pairs of picture signals being demultiplexed of image decoder are decoded and scaler 335 scales the figure being decoded As the resolution ratio of signal, to allow display 180 to export the picture signal being decoded.
Image decoder 325 can include the decoder of various standards.
Processor 330 can control the integrated operation of the component of image display device 100 or the component of controller 170. For example, processor 330 can control the channel or relative with pre-stored channel that the tuning of tuner unit 110 is selected with user The RF broadcast answered.
According to the user command inputted by user's input interface unit 150 or can according to internal processes processor 330 To control image display device 100.
Processor 330 can perform the data transfer control with NIU 135 or external apparatus interface unit 130 System.
In addition, processor 330 can control demultiplexer 310, graphics processing unit 320, OSD in controller 170 to give birth to Grow up to be a useful person 340 operation.
OSD maker 340 inputs or independently generated osd signal according to user.For example, based on user input signal OSD maker 340 can be generated for showing various information in the form of figure or text on the screen of display 180 Signal.The osd signal being generated can include the various data of image display device 100, such as user interface screen, respectively plant vegetables Single-screen, widget, icon etc..In addition, the osd signal being generated can also include 2D objects or 3D objects.
In addition, can generate and can be shown based on the directional signal OSD maker 340 received from remote control equipment 200 Indicator over the display.Especially, can be by the directional signal processor that can be included in OSD maker 340 (not shown) can generate indicator.Certainly, directional signal processor (not shown) can be provided without in OSD maker 340 In and can provide separatedly.
Associated with embodiments of the invention, when signing in image display device 100, OSD maker 340 can be generated Or configure default personal screen.Alternatively, when signing in accessed server, OSD maker 340 can give birth to Into or at least a portion of server access screen for receiving of the corresponding server of configuration slave phase, to allow server access Screen is displayed on display 180.Alternatively, based on the webserver on having been accessed by personal information Information, OSD maker 340 can generate or configure at least a portion that the corresponding webserver connects screen.
Frequency mixer 345 can be mixed the osd signal generated by OSD maker 340 and be entered by graphics processing unit 320 The picture signal being decoded that row image procossing is produced.In this case, in osd signal and the picture signal being decoded Each can include at least one in 2D signals and 3D signals.The picture signal being first mixed is provided to block diagram of frame rate converter 350。
Block diagram of frame rate converter 350 can change the frame per second of input picture.Meanwhile, block diagram of frame rate converter 350 can also be in no frame Rate directly exports input picture in the case of changing.
Formatter 360 can be received and exported after the form of change signal is so as to suitable for display 180 by mixing The signal that device 345 is mixed, that is, (osd signal and the picture signal being decoded).For example, formatter 360 can export R, G and B data signal, R, the G and B data signal can be output by low voltage differential command (LVDS) or mini LVDS.
Input signal can be separated into 2D picture signals and the 3D rendering signal shown for 3D rendering by formatter 360. In addition, formatter 360 can also change the form of 3D rendering signal or 2D picture signals can be converted into 3D rendering signal.

Fig. 3 shows the control method of the remote control equipment shown in Fig. 1.
In figure 3, (a) shows that indicator 205 wherein corresponding with remote control equipment 200 is displayed on display 180 Example.
User can up and down or to the left and to the right (as shown in (b) in Fig. 3) or forwardly and rearwardly (such as Shown in Fig. 3 (c)) mobile remote control equipment 200, or remote control equipment 200 can be rotated.It is displayed on image display device Indicator 205 on display 180 corresponds to the movement of remote control equipment 200.Because indicator 205 is displayed on display 180 Above cause the mobile movement indicator 205 of the remote control equipment 200 in the 3d space being such as exemplarily illustrated in figure 3, institute Space telecontrol equipment (that is, instruction device) can be referred to as with remote control equipment 200.
In figure 3, (b) shows wherein when user is moved to the left remote control equipment 200, to be displayed on image display device The example that indicator 205 on display 180 is moved to the left according to the movement of remote control equipment 200.
The information quilt of the movement of the remote control equipment 200 sensed on the sensor (not shown) by remote control equipment 200 It is sent to image display device.Frame display device based on the movement on remote control equipment 200 can calculate indicator 205 coordinate.Image display device can show indicator 205 according to the coordinate calculated.
In figure 3, (c) shows to move remote control equipment 200 wherein when user presses the specific button on remote control equipment 200 Example away from display 180.This allow the selected region of the display 180 corresponding with indicator 205 exaggerated and Expand.On the contrary, pressing the specific button on remote control equipment 200 simultaneously close to display 180 when user's mobile remote control equipment 200 When, the selected region of the display 180 corresponding with indicator 205 can be reduced and shrink.On the contrary, when remote control is set Selected region can be reduced and when remote control equipment 200 moves close to display when moving away from display 180 for 200 Selected region can be exaggerated when 180.
Can not be detected when the predetermined button on remote control equipment 200 is pressed the upper and lower movement of remote control equipment 200 with And left and right movement.That is, when remote control equipment 200 is moved away from or close to display 180 when, remote control equipment 200 it is upward, to Under, to the left and move right and cannot be detected, and the forwardly and rearwardly movement of only remote control equipment 200 can be detected Arrive.When the specific button on remote control equipment 200 is not pressed, according only to remote control equipment 200 it is upward, downward, to the left with And the movement indicator 205 that moves right.
Meanwhile, the translational speed of indicator 205 or direction can correspond to translational speed or the direction of remote control equipment 200.
